About Aston University

Founded in 1895 and a University since 1966, Aston is a long established research-led university known for its world-class teaching quality and strong links to business and the professions.

Aston University was announced as the Guardian’s University of the Year 2020 and winner of the Times Higher Education’s (THE) 2020 Outstanding Entrepreneurial University, in recognition of our support for student entrepreneurship, small businesses, and the West Midlands region.

Aston University is recruiting to a key role in the Procurement Team.  Reporting to the Head of Procurement and Insurance, this role is a great opportunity to contribute to the development of the University’s procurement function and lead on the procurement of contractors and consultants for the projects to deliver Aston's campus vision and masterplan as well contracts for ongoing maintenance and repair and smaller standalone projects.

Our Campus Vision is ambitious; it will see us create a campus that offers an outstanding experience for our staff and students, bring improvements to surrounding communities and to the people of Birmingham and utilise the opportunities presented by our proximity to HS2, Innovation Birmingham, Eastside and the city centre. Our vision sets out our aspiration to invest significantly into the delivery of a Destination Campus to meet the changing demands and opportunities faced by universities evolving in response to these in order to secure Aston’s future success. The University intends to invest £240 million over 10 years, to deliver our campus vision.

With 15,000 students from more than 120 countries, Aston University is a safe and friendly campus enjoyed by a global, multicultural community. Aston’s diverse student population comprises the largest proportion of Black and Minority Ethnic (BAME) students in the UK (2021 Times/Sunday Times Good University Guide Social Inclusion Rankings).

Centrally located campus in the heart of Birmingham

The Aston University 40-acre campus is ideally located on one site in the vibrant city of Birmingham.  The city is recognised as a leader in leisure, entertainment, shopping and sport and is an
international centre for business, commerce and industry. 

One of the ‘greenest’ universities in the UK,  the academic campus houses all the social and accommodation facilities for our students and is within walking distance to the city.
